The stock of Expeditors International Of Washington, Inc. (EXPD) has gone up by 3.79% for the week, with a 4.76% rise in the past month and a -0.48% drop in the past quarter. The volatility ratio for the week is 1.69%, and the volatility levels for the past 30 days are 1.75% for EXPD.. The simple moving average for the past 20 days is 2.54% for EXPD’s stock, with a 3.23% simple moving average for the past 200 days.

Is It Worth Investing in Expeditors International Of Washington, Inc. (NYSE: EXPD) Right Now?

Expeditors International Of Washington, Inc. (NYSE: EXPD) has a higher price-to-earnings ratio of 26.98x compared to its average ratio. EXPD has 36-month beta value of 0.96. Analysts have mixed views on the stock, with 1 analysts rating it as a “buy,” 1 as “overweight,” 10 as “hold,” and 2 as “sell.”

The public float for EXPD is 140.11M, and currently, short sellers hold a 2.24% ratio of that float. The average trading volume of EXPD on September 20, 2024 was 1.18M shares.

Analysts’ Opinion of EXPD

Exane BNP Paribas, on the other hand, stated in their research note that they expect to see EXPD reach a price target of $112. The rating they have provided for EXPD stocks is “Neutral” according to the report published on May 14th, 2024.

TD Cowen gave a rating of “Hold” to EXPD, setting the target price at $112 in the report published on May 08th of the current year.

Insider Trading

Reports are indicating that there were more than several insider trading activities at EXPD starting from DuBois James M., who sale 3,523 shares at the price of $123.05 back on Jun 14 ’24. After this action, DuBois James M. now owns 19,829 shares of Expeditors International Of Washington, Inc., valued at $433,505 using the latest closing price.

Emmert Mark A, the Director of Expeditors International Of Washington, Inc., sale 8,100 shares at $123.67 during a trade that took place back on Jun 14 ’24, which means that Emmert Mark A is holding 14,085 shares at $1,001,686 based on the most recent closing price.

Stock Fundamentals for EXPD

Current profitability levels for the company are sitting at:

  • 0.09 for the present operating margin
  • 0.15 for the gross margin

The net margin for Expeditors International Of Washington, Inc. stands at 0.07. The total capital return value is set at 0.33. Equity return is now at value 28.51, with 14.43 for asset returns.

Based on Expeditors International Of Washington, Inc. (EXPD), the company’s capital structure generated 0.2 points at debt to capital in total, while cash flow to debt ratio is standing at 1.32. The debt to equity ratio resting at 0.25. The interest coverage ratio of the stock is 485.32.

Currently, EBITDA for the company is 1.01 billion with net debt to EBITDA at -0.77. When we switch over and look at the enterprise to sales, we see a ratio of 1.87. The receivables turnover for the company is 4.94for trailing twelve months and the total asset turnover is 1.9. The liquidity ratio also appears to be rather interesting for investors as it stands at 1.53.
